What ephemera Does

ephemera is a npm in the npm category. Extracts sections of uuids and transforms them into properties on vanilla object for use in games, simulations, and tests.. It is published by brycefisher and has no specified license. With 0 GitHub stars and 0 downloads, it has a small community of users and contributors.
